A Kids Bunkbed Is a Great Choice For Shared Bedrooms and Sleepovers

Bunk beds are a great option for space-saving and are well-liked for shared bedrooms and sleepovers. They're available in a variety of styles and materials and usually cost less than two beds.

Bunk beds are ideal for reducing space in a small room. Some models let you to adjust the configuration to ensure that each child has their own twin or full-size bed. You can also find numerous bunk bed options that come with storage drawers, stairs and trundles to maximize sleeping and study space. Some bunk beds can be separated to create two separate beds. This is a great option when your kids get out of the bunks, or when you move.

The quality of the bunkbed for kids depends on the materials used, its design and layout. Consumer Product Safety Commission recommends that you choose an item with strong guardrails. These must be at least 5 inches tall. Also, ensure that the top bunk is not too close to the ceiling or near any window sills, since this can lead to dangerous falls.

Easy to Climb

Bunk beds are a great option to make space in your child's bedroom, and kids love them because they're fun. But bunks can be difficult for children to climb up and down without assistance especially the top bunk. There are some things you can do to help the climb for little ones.

One of the most effective ways to make a bunk bed more comfortable to climb is to select a design with an integrated ladder. This eliminates the need for a separate staircase, and is more secure than traditional bunk beds that have exposed ladders. Some ladders even have railings on both sides, offering an additional level of security for your kids.

Another option is to add a side three-step ladder to your child's bunk bed. This is a safe and easy-to-climb ladder ideal for kids who have grown out of their toddler beds but aren't quite ready for the top bunk yet. It is crucial to wait for your child to be at minimum six before allowing them the top bunk. Also, make sure that you install a guardrail on the top of the bunk.
